Capitola’s roots as a holiday resort go way back to the 1860s, and you can get a taste of the past at the Capitola Historical Museum. It may be small, but it makes a fascinating diversion from the outdoor attractions, with regularly changing exhibitions displaying photos, artworks and other artifacts telling the long and colorful story of the region. The museum even has an interactive exhibit in the form of a lovingly reconstructed cottage from the area’s early years as a vacation location which gives you an idea of what Capitola vacation rentals once looked like.

As you might expect from somewhere poised on Monterey Bay, the most popular time to book a Capitola vacation rental is summer. The months from June to August are perfect for lazing on the beaches or getting stuck into wet and wild adventures in the bay itself, so slather on the sunscreen and enjoy yourself. That said, many locals will also recommend the fall season, when the crowds are less intense and you can still enjoy the fine sunshine. Come the cooler months, you can take advantage of better rates and hop on a boat tour to spot Gray whales migrating through the winter waters.
Capitola is a place of vivid colors, whether you’re looking out at the deep blue of Monterey Bay, the playful pinks and yellows of the village condos, or the lush green of surrounding vegetation, ranging from oak and eucalyptus trees to Monterey cypresses. Forested areas hug the curving coastline, providing cool respite from the sun-soaked beaches, while you can get a closer look at dolphins and whales by stepping out onto Capitola Wharf. This wooden pier a refreshingly no-frills affair – ideal for strolling and gazing out at the bay, or indulging in a spot of fishing.
